Leftover Ham Meatloaf

"This is a great way to use up leftover cooked ham, since this makes two meat loaves you can freeze one uncooked, just omit the chili sauce and bacon on top, thaw in refrigerator overnight, top with tomato sauce and bacon, then bake as directed."

directions

  • Set oven to 350 degrees.
  • Prepare foil-lined 10 x 15-inch baking sheet, then place a rack in the pan.
  • In a large bowl using clean hands mix together all the meatloaf ingredients.
  • Shape into two 9x5-inch loaves and place onto the rack in the baking sheet, or just cook one and freeze the other for another meal.
  • Pour about 1 cup chili sauce onto each top of loaf, then place 2-3 bacon slices over the top lengthwise.
  • Bake for about 40-45 minutes.
